Meta prices Muse Spark 1.1 at $1.25/1M input tokens and $4.25/1M output tokens; Alexandr Wang says improving coding and agentic performance was a key focus

Ina Fried /Axios:

Axios Ina Fried

Context & Ripple Effects

Meta moved Muse Spark from a private API preview for select partners toward broader paid access, then launched the Meta Model API with pricing positioned at roughly a quarter of OpenAI and Anthropic alternatives. Publishing Muse Spark 1.1 token rates makes that positioning concrete.

The model effort sits within Meta Superintelligence Labs under Alexandr Wang, with Muse Spark also intended to improve Meta AI. The stated emphasis on coding and agentic work aligns the commercial API with capabilities Meta is also building into its products.

First-order effects

  • Developers can evaluate Muse Spark 1.1 against competing APIs using explicit $1.25-per-million input-token and $4.25-per-million output-token rates, lowering the uncertainty around adopting Meta's model API.
  • Meta gains a direct route to monetize Muse Spark outside its own products while using coding and agentic performance as its primary workload pitch.

Second-order effects

  • Lower published token prices pressure other frontier-model API vendors to defend pricing or demonstrate enough performance, reliability, or tooling advantage to justify a premium.
  • For application builders with code-generation or agent workflows, model selection becomes more sensitive to output-token costs, since those workloads can generate substantial model output.

Third-order effects

  • If Meta sustains its stated low-price posture, frontier-model competition could shift further from model access alone toward the economics and developer experience of operating agentic applications.
  • Meta's simultaneous use of Muse Spark in Meta AI and sale through an API points to a broader convergence between consumer AI distribution and enterprise developer platforms; whether it becomes a durable cloud-style business depends on adoption beyond Meta's own ecosystem.

The trend: This is one data point in the shift from closed frontier models as premium endpoints toward aggressively priced APIs competing for coding and agentic workloads.
